Files
qbtmud/Lantean.QBTMud/Components/ApplicationActions.razor
2024-10-22 09:57:50 +01:00

28 lines
955 B
Plaintext

@if (IsMenu)
{
@foreach (var action in Actions)
{
if (action.SeparatorBefore)
{
<MudDivider />
}
<MudMenuItem Icon="@action.Icon" IconColor="@action.Color" Href="@action.Href">@action.Text</MudMenuItem>
}
<MudMenuItem Icon="@Icons.Material.Filled.Undo" OnClick="ResetWebUI">Reset Web UI</MudMenuItem>
<MudDivider />
<MudMenuItem Icon="@Icons.Material.Filled.Logout" OnClick="Logout">Logout</MudMenuItem>
<MudMenuItem Icon="@Icons.Material.Filled.ExitToApp" OnClick="Exit">Exit qBittorrent</MudMenuItem>
}
else
{
<MudNavLink Icon="@Icons.Material.Outlined.Navigation" OnClick="NavigateBack">Torrents</MudNavLink>
<MudDivider />
@foreach (var action in Actions)
{
if (action.SeparatorBefore)
{
<MudDivider />
}
<MudNavLink Icon="@action.Icon" IconColor="@action.Color" Href="@action.Href">@action.Text</MudNavLink>
}
}